Abstract

This study confirmed the reliability and validity of the Quality Indicators of Exemplary Transition Programs Needs Assessment–2 (QI-2). Quality transition program indicators were identified through a systematic synthesis of transition research, policies, and program evaluation measures. To verify reliability and validity of the QI-2, we administered rigorous methods including a content analysis, an expert review, and instrument field test. Forty-seven indicators were categorized into seven domains: (a) transition planning, (b) transition assessment, (c) family involvement, (d) student involvement, (e) transition-focused curriculum and instruction, (f) interagency collaboration, and (g) systems-level infrastructure. The QI-2 was found to be reliable and valid for use by transition stakeholders, districts, and states for evaluating quality of transition programs and identifying areas for program improvement.
